# Staking parameters

1. Transfer the $ODI BRC-20 token from holder wallet to escrow pool.

   1. Create escrow<br>

      <figure><img src="https://1037555705-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F7atoN5YTKDtLaX5DvZDp%2Fuploads%2FXwdnf5sLyrAVpIFYPQ34%2Fimage.png?alt=media&#x26;token=0546e2ff-6770-49b3-b6f4-f8b7b71ed3fc" alt=""><figcaption></figcaption></figure>

   2. Create Assets<br>

      <figure><img src="https://1037555705-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F7atoN5YTKDtLaX5DvZDp%2Fuploads%2FsSSU82v0mG6YhZMIatZk%2Fimage.png?alt=media&#x26;token=0336dfa1-7823-4ff6-bad6-f637606d79a7" alt=""><figcaption></figcaption></figure>

   3. Create outcome<br>

      <figure><img src="https://1037555705-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F7atoN5YTKDtLaX5DvZDp%2Fuploads%2FSVr3u3cmfiSDodbRyCCx%2Fimage.png?alt=media&#x26;token=47d49c3b-1ec3-44fe-a1ed-10b48d5ae7f3" alt=""><figcaption></figcaption></figure>

   4. Transfer $ODI BRC-20 token to escrow pool

<figure><img src="https://1037555705-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F7atoN5YTKDtLaX5DvZDp%2Fuploads%2FKHeF1g0qeT0qE0sQWXRt%2Fimage.png?alt=media&#x26;token=096b0a1e-d5e9-4821-8eef-78810745facf" alt=""><figcaption></figcaption></figure>

1. Set the options such as lock time and store it to DB
   1. Set the locktime to 1, 3, 6, 12 months
   2. store options to DB using mongoAPI
